The Anatomy Beneath the Surface: A Closer Look
The hypothalamus, located at the base of the brain, is a small but mighty structure that governs the pituitary gland, often referred to as the "master gland" because it regulates other endocrine glands in the body. The pituitary itself is divided into two parts: the anterior pituitary, which is glandular in nature and releases hormones like growth hormone and prolactin; and the posterior pituitary, which is essentially an extension of the hypothalamus, releasing hormones such as oxytocin and antidiuretic hormone.
Why Understanding These Hormones is Crucial
For medical students and healthcare professionals, grasping the functions of hypothalamic and pituitary hormones is essential for diagnosing and treating various conditions. For instance, growth hormone plays a vital role during childhood and adolescence, impacting growth and development. In contrast, prolactin is crucial for milk production in nursing mothers. A deficiency or excess in these hormones can lead to significant health issues, emphasizing the need for thorough understanding and monitoring of these hormonal levels.
